Transaction 29514819c029ff6f80d5a5f77b93e1e87af9e25f669825ded84a4e8a69468d90

3 Input
1 Outputs
  • 29514819c029ff6f80d5a5f77b93e1e87af9e25f669825ded84a4e8a69468d90:0
  • value  50000000
    address  3A5rCoSkkPHeHgvcUP9CUrTfTS3dDoPSbh